Restricted Parking Zone (RPZ) Program
The Restricted Parking Zone (RPZ) Program allows the City to reserve on-street parking for the exclusive use of abutting properties in a specific area, and their visitors. An RPZ can also reserve on-street parking during certain posted hours, allowing unrestricted parking at other times. Please note that a permit does not guarantee that an on-street parking space will always be available.

Current RPZ are located in the Lea Hill Village neighborhood near Green River College, in the West Main Street neighborhood near the Auburn Transit Center, and on D St near West Auburn Senior High School; see maps below.

Owners of residential properties located in an RPZ are eligible for one parking permit per vehicle registered to their address (up to a maximum of three permits), plus one guest permit. These permits are provided free of charge.

Permit Conditions
The person to whom permit is issued is presumed to be responsive for appropriate permit use, including guest pass.
Permits are nontransferable and are valid for the applicable vehicle registered above only.
Vehicle and driver's license registration address must coincide with the residential address of applicant above.
Property owners are required to return permits and notify city when moving.
Renters are required to return permit to the property owner or city when moving.
Violation of the above or any section of ACC 10.41 will result in revocation of permit. Applicant will not be eligible for replacement permits for a period of one year.
